Effects of Deep Transverse Friction Massage and Instrument Assisted Soft Tissue Mobilization in Plantar Fasciitis.

May 4, 2026 updated by: Riphah International University

Comparative Effects of Deep Transverse Friction Massage and Instrument Assisted Soft Tissue Mobilization Techniques on Pain Intensity, Disability and Functional Capacity in Plantar Fasciitis.

The objective of study is to compare the pain intensity, disability and functional capacity by Deep Transverse Friction Massage and Instrument Assisted Soft Tissue Mobilization Techniques in patients with plantar fasciitis.

Detailed Description

This randomized clinical trial will be conducted at Ghurki Trust and Teaching Hospital and Jinnah Hospital, Lahore. The study will target pregnant females aged 18 to 40 years who are clinically diagnosed with plantar fasciitis using the Windlass test. Exclusion criteria include a history of ankle or foot fracture or surgery within the past six months, as well as any neurological deficits. A total of 52 participants will be recruited using the non-probability convenience sampling technique and randomly assigned into two equal groups. Participants in both groups will receive the same baseline treatment. Group A will receive Deep Transverse Friction Massage (DTFM), while Group B will receive Instrument Assisted Soft Tissue Mobilization Techniques (IASTMT). The study aims to compare the effectiveness of these two manual therapy techniques on pain intensity, disability, and functional capacity. The Numeric Pain Rating Scale (NPRS) will be used to assess pain levels. Disability will be evaluated using the Foot Function Index (FFI), and the 6-Minute Walk Test (6MWT) will be employed to measure functional capacity. Data collected from participants will be entered and statistically analyzed using SPSS version 21 to determine the comparative effectiveness of the two treatment approaches in managing plantar fasciitis during pregnancy.

Inclusion Criteria:

  • Pregnant females Second trimester 12th to 34th week
  • Multiparous
  • Plantar fasciitis diagnoses with Windlass test
  • NPRS pain level 3 to 7

Exclusion Criteria:

  • History of ankle and foot fractures
  • Surgery in previous 6 months

    • Neurologic deficit High risk pregnancy
  • Previous manual therapy interventions for the foot region
  • Those who previously received systemic or local steroid injection within 3 months or locally injected with any other material
  • Dermatological disease i.e; injury, trauma, foot ulcer over the foot

Experimental: DEEP TRANSVERSE FRICTION MASSAGE
Deep friction massage (DFM), also known as cross friction massage, is a specific connective tissue massage
12 sessions total (approx.1 and half month) and 2 sessions per week with mild to moderate manual pressure. 15 - 20 min per session will be given to patient for 6 weeks
Experimental: INSTRUMENT ASSISTED SOFT TISSUE MOBILIZATION TECHNIQUES
ASTM techniques involve the use of specialized instruments to manipulate soft tissue structures. These instruments are designed to provide an efficient detection of soft tissue dysfunction and accurate application of force during treatment.
• 12 sessions total, (approximately 1 and half month) and 2 sessions per week. Low to moderate pressure with tool will applied for 15 - 20 min per session for 6 weeks

Numeric Pain Rating Scale (NPRS)
Time Frame: 6th week
The Numeric Pain Rating Scale (NPRS) was employed to evaluate pain intensity for all participants in both groups prior to and following the 8-week intervention program. This is 11-point (0-10) self-reporting tool is presented as a 10-cm horizontal line where 0 indicates no pain, 1-3 signifies mild pain, 4-6 represents moderate pain, and 7-10 denotes severe pain. The maximum value corresponds to the worst pain, while the minimum value indicates the absence of pain.

Foot Function Index (FFI)
Time Frame: 6th week
A Foot Function Index (FFI) was developed to measure the impact of foot pathology on function in terms of pain, disability and activity restriction. The FFI is a self-administered index consisting of 23 items divided into 3 sub-scales. Both total and sub-scale scores are produced.
